January 31 (SeeNews) - Sales of Swedish fashion retailer Hennes & Mauritz (H&M) in Bulgaria grew by 25% to 641 million Swedish crowns ($73 million/68 million euro) in the fiscal year 2016, ending November 30, the company said on Tuesday.
In local currency, H&M’s sales in Bulgaria increased by an annual 25% in the period under review, the company said in its annual financial report.
On a quarterly basis, H&M's sales in Bulgaria increased by 22% to 181 million Swedish crowns in the September - November period. In local currency, the company’s sales in the fourth quarter increased by 19%.
H&M opened one new store in Bulgaria during the fiscal year 2016, bringing the total number of stores it operates in the country to 19.
(1 euro = 9.4456 Swedish crowns)
